Roughly 10% of Microsoft Employees Using iPhones

It shouldn't be a surprise that Microsoft employees are like the rest of us, and enjoy their gadgets. However, what is surprising is that an estimated 10% of Microsoft's global workforce is using the iPhone. That estimate comes from 10,000 users that accessed Microsoft's employee email system from an iPhone last year. As you might expect, this doesn't sit well with Microsoft's top brass, especially CEO Steve Ballmer. It was said that during a company meeting Mr. Ballmer snatched an iPhone from an employee’s hand, placed it on the ground and pretended to stomp on it.

Robbie Bach, Microsoft's president of the Entertainment & Devices division, said that employees often use a number of devices from competitors to "better understand the competition." According to the WSJ, Kevin Turner, Microsoft's COO, scoffed at Mr. Bach's explanation.

While some employees use their iPhones openly and in plain view of others, some employees go to great lengths to disguise their iPhones using cases in an attempt to make the iPhone look more like a generic phone.
